USDA awards $1.15 million to expand technology that warns producers before pigs start showing signs of heat stress
COLUMBIA, Mo. — Summer heat can turn into a real problem in a hog barn, and by the time pigs start panting, producers may already be behind the curve.
A University of Missouri researcher is working to change that.
Jay Johnson, an associate professor with Mizzou’s College of Agriculture, Food and Natural Resources, has received a $1.15 million USDA grant to expand HotHog, a free smartphone app designed to help pork producers spot heat stress risks before the pigs show obvious signs.
Pigs cannot sweat, which makes hot and humid weather especially tough on them.
Heat stress can slow growth, hurt reproductive performance, affect animal welfare and, when conditions get severe, lead to death losses.
Johnson says the goal is to give producers a warning before the trouble starts.
HotHog uses local weather information to show producers how temperature and humidity could affect their pigs. Producers can enter multiple barn locations and receive alerts when conditions reach certain risk levels.
That gives them time to make adjustments.
They can check ventilation, change sprinkler settings, make changes to water systems or reconsider when pigs should be moved.
The app has been around since 2023 and is already being used by more than 2,000 people in more than 50 countries.
Now the USDA funding will allow Johnson and his research team to take the technology further.
Different Pigs Handle Heat Differently
A weather forecast may tell you it is going to be 95 degrees, but that number does not tell the whole story inside a hog barn.
Humidity matters, and so does the type of pig.
A sow carrying pigs has different heat stress risks than a recently weaned pig. A hog close to market weight has different needs as well.
The current HotHog system focuses mainly on sows that produce and nurse piglets.
The new research will expand the app to include recently weaned pigs, growing pigs approaching market weight and market weight hogs.
That should give producers a much better picture of what the weather could mean for the animals they have in the barn.
Mizzou Will Study Pigs Under Controlled Conditions
The research will include work at Mizzou’s Animal Science Research Center and a new thermocline facility being built at South Farm.
Researchers will be able to expose pigs to controlled temperature conditions and monitor how they respond.
Video cameras will record the animals as temperatures change.
The researchers will use those observations to better identify when heat stress starts and how different groups of pigs react.
That information will then be used to improve the HotHog app and the recommendations it provides to producers.
The goal is to give producers information they can use before the heat becomes an animal health or production problem.
Research Reaches Beyond Missouri
Johnson’s project will include researchers from Purdue University, the University of Pretoria in South Africa and the University of Melbourne in Australia.
The international partnership will help researchers account for different climates and pork production systems.
That could eventually make HotHog useful to producers dealing with heat stress in a variety of conditions around the world.
Here in Missouri, MU Extension specialists will work with Johnson and his team to help producers learn how to use the app.
They will also collect feedback from producers about how the technology works in actual hog operations.
And there is no subscription fee.
Johnson says HotHog will remain free because he wants producers to have access to the information without adding another expense to the operation.
For Missouri pork producers, the technology is another tool for dealing with one of the toughest parts of summer.
When the heat index starts climbing, waiting until pigs are already panting is too late.
The goal of HotHog is to give producers the warning they need to make a move before the heat starts costing them.
